Prairie Forum, vol. 9, no. 2, Fall, 1984, pp. 181-201
Description
Outlines the progression of mineral resource use in the Canadian Plains, from surface minerals, to buried deposits such as oil, gas, coal, potash, sodium, sulphate and sulphur.
Prairie Forum, vol. 9, no. 1, Spring, 1984, pp. 1-11
Description
Looks at the repeated crop failures at Red River that compelled settlers to use wild hay from the plains, as well as support the colony by hunting, fishing, and fowling.
